TA & Reserves including Full Time Reserve Service (FTRS)
The Directorate of Manning (Army) is responsible for the Terms of Service governing the TA and Reserves specifically Full Time Reserve Service (FTRS).
There are three types of FTRS engagement:
Full Commitment (FC)
Limited Commitment (LC)
Home Commitment (HC)
As their titles suggest, each of these categories carries with it varying degrees of commitment for deployment and employment of the individual volunteer. Details of these engagements (which are open to members of the TA and Regular Reservists) are contained in TA Regulations, the Compendium of Reservist Regulations and via the chain of command from the TA and Reserves MCM Division at the Army Personnel Centre, Glasgow. The rates of pay and conditions available for these engagements vary slightly, in order to reflect the nature of the duties, which an individual will be performing.
The details of FTRS vacancies are listed in the TA JobShop on the Army Website and are routinely updated. Application forms for FTRS are held in the various annexes to TA Regulations.
The Directorate of Manning (Army) is the responsible authority for much of the TA Regulations. As such it is routinely called upon to decide and adjudicate in matters concerning discharge from the TA and Reserves and appeals with regards to Terms of Service.
In addition, The Directorate of Manning (Army) governs the Terms of Service relating to Non Regular Permanent Staff (NRPS), Sponsored Reserves (SR) and all conventional categories of TA personnel and Regular Army Reservists.
